The Colorado Avalanche held their annual Meet the Team party for season ticket holders. This fun event took place on October 25.

The Colorado Avalanche did their “meet the team” party this season at Pepsi Center. The meet the team party is for season tickets holders to get a chance to meet and mingle with the players and attending staff. This was my first year attending.

This year was interesting due to the fact they also made it Halloween themed. I dressed up with my friends like the Hanson Brothers:

They had a costume contest but sadly not many fans dresses up. Nor did the players. Regardless it was still fun.

In case you don’t remember, the Hanson brothers were characters in the 1977 movie Slap Shot. While the movie characters were fictional, they were based on the Carlson brothers, actual hockey players. They’re known for their silly hi-jinks — and their thick nerd glasses.

They did a couple autograph sessions, but you only got to go to one. They had a total of four sessions. Then they had other events going on as well, including playing cornhole, a locker room tour, pictures with players, and mini rink (16 and under).

I played cornhole a couple times, the first was against EJ and the second Nemo was my partner. They blow everyone out of the water, I couldn’t even hit the cornhole board most the time.

They also had members from Altitudes broadcast team and the in-game entertainment team. My friends and I got some fun pictures with Marc Moser, Lauren, Mark Rycroft, and Peter McNab. I was so happy everyone caught Hanson fever:

All in all I think this was a good event if you wanted to do more then just have players sign autographs or take pictures.

The best part after they introduced the team. Captain Gabriel Landeskog gave a speech. There is apparently a tradition where he puts a young guy on the spot. This year it was Samuel Girard and he killed it:

That’s right — it’s our tiny defenseman showing he has a huge voice.
